Common Signs of Rodent Infestation

It’s essential to recognize the signs of rodent infestation early. Look for chewed wires, droppings, and shredded materials, which can indicate that rodents are making themselves at home. In addition, if you hear scratching noises or see small footprints in dusty areas, these could be clues that you’re dealing with an uninvited guest.

How to Remove Rodent Nesting Areas

Removing rodent nesting areas typically requires several steps, and a professional exterminator will know the best practices. First, they will seal entry points to prevent further infestations. This may involve closing gaps in walls, fitting vents with screens, or using caulk to block holes.

After sealing entry points, traps and baits can be strategically placed to ensure that existing rodents are caught. It’s essential to use methods that are not only effective but also safe for the occupants of the home.
